Transaction 50680f2aeb5206c59f02cad3c3cfe9471bd627d095dc5790810b443d2b6ec7d9
1 Input
2 Outputs
- 50680f2aeb5206c59f02cad3c3cfe9471bd627d095dc5790810b443d2b6ec7d9:0
- 50680f2aeb5206c59f02cad3c3cfe9471bd627d095dc5790810b443d2b6ec7d9:1
value 129524
address 3Gp24iMK7ppKCqg4VdnVDdcqrAHFqUztvU
value 581250
address 1MEarhpnWvWg2NerHYStEAjkXGyMP2u79b